The manual chain block & tackle takes the effort out of lifting heavy goods. Can be used for a wide variety of lifting operations.

Features:
- Manual operated chain block hoist hire for heavy lifting in many situations.
- Versatile lifting with precision control.
- Also known as a Chain Hoist or Block and Tackle, the chain block is popular lifting solution.
